What is a portable speaker?
A portable speaker is a compact, battery-powered audio device designed to play music or sound without needing to be plugged into a wall. Unlike traditional home speakers, it's built for movement, so you can carry it from your living room to your backyard or even take it on a road trip.
Most portable speakers connect to your phone or laptop through Bluetooth, making setup quick and cable-free. They usually come with rechargeable batteries, rugged exteriors, and compact shapes that make them easy to carry in a bag. Despite their small size, many now deliver sound quality that rivals bigger, wired speakers.
The Evolution of Portable Speaker Technology
Portable speakers started out simple. Early models were basic, battery-powered boxes with weak sound and short battery life. They worked fine for casual listening, but the bass was thin, and the volume dropped quickly in open spaces.
Over time, things changed fast. Bluetooth replaced wires, batteries lasted longer, and manufacturers began focusing on sound quality instead of just portability. Waterproof designs appeared, allowing speakers to survive pool parties and rainy hikes. Today's portable Bluetooth speaker use smarter chips, better materials, and refined engineering to deliver bigger sound from smaller bodies. What was once a simple gadget has become a serious piece of audio technology, built to compete with home sound systems yet still easy to carry anywhere.
Why Portable Speakers Keep Getting More Powerful
Portable speakers aren't just louder now, they're smarter. Improvements in technology across several areas work together to boost power without adding size. Here's a closer look at what's really driving this shift.
Smarter Amplifier Technology
Good portable speakers use digital amplifiers that are far more efficient than older analog designs. These amplifiers convert battery power into sound with less energy loss, which means louder output without draining the battery faster. This shift lets manufacturers pack more punch into smaller housings, giving users powerful sound that once required much bigger, bulkier equipment.
Better Battery Efficiency
Battery technology has improved just as much as sound engineering. Modern lithium-ion batteries store more energy in smaller cells, allowing speakers to play longer at higher volumes. Smart power management also helps by directing energy where it's needed most during playback. The result is a speaker that stays loud for hours, not just minutes, without needing a bigger, heavier battery pack.
Advanced Driver & Bass Engineering
Speaker drivers have gotten smarter, not just stronger. Engineers now design multiple drivers and passive radiators that work together to produce deep bass without needing extra space. Materials like reinforced diaphragms help reduce distortion at high volumes. This means even small speakers can now deliver rich, punchy bass that once only came from much larger, traditional sound systems.
Wireless & Multi-Speaker Connectivity
Bluetooth technology has evolved to support faster, more stable connections with better sound quality. Many portable Bluetooth speakers can now pair with two or more speakers at once, creating a fuller, louder sound across a room or outdoor space. This multi-speaker linking turns a single small device into part of a bigger, more powerful sound system, all without a single wire.
Durability Upgrades
Portable speakers today are built to survive real-world conditions, not just careful handling. Many now feature IP67 or IP68 ratings, protecting them from dust, rain, and even full submersion in water. Rugged exteriors and shockproof designs help them handle drops, bumps, and rough outdoor use. This durability means users can enjoy powerful sound without worrying about damaging their speaker.
Compact Design Despite More Power
Despite all these upgrades, portable speakers haven't grown bigger; they've gotten smarter. Engineers now use space more efficiently, fitting powerful components into tighter, well-organized layouts. Better cooling, lighter materials, and compact circuit designs all help maintain a small footprint. The result is a compact speaker that delivers a big, room-filling sound while still being light and easy to carry.
Portable Speakers for Different Uses
Different situations call for different sound needs. Whether you're outdoors, hosting a party, relaxing at home, or working professionally, today's portable speakers are built to perform well in every setting.
Outdoor Activities
A portable outdoor speaker are perfect companions for hiking, camping, beach trips, and picnics. Their rugged, waterproof designs handle dust, splashes, and rough handling with ease. Long battery life means music can keep playing for hours without needing a recharge. Strong bass and clear sound also ensure the audio stays enjoyable even in open, noisy outdoor environments.
Parties and Events
For parties and gatherings, portable speakers offer big, room-filling sound without the hassle of complicated setups. Many models support pairing multiple speakers together, creating a louder, fuller experience across large spaces. Built-in lights and party modes add extra fun to the atmosphere. Their portability also means you can easily move the sound wherever the party goes.
Home Entertainment
At home, portable speakers make a great alternative to bulky sound systems. They're perfect for movie nights, casual music listening, or background sound while cooking or relaxing. Many connect easily to TVs, laptops, or phones through Bluetooth. Their compact size also means you can move them from room to room, adjusting your setup wherever you need better sound.
Professional Use
Portable Bluetooth speakers are also becoming valuable tools for professionals. Presenters, teachers, and small event hosts use them for clear voice projection without needing heavy equipment. Some models even support microphone input, making them useful for outdoor classes or small public speaking events. Their portability makes it easy to set up quality sound in almost any professional setting.
